The Magic of 2s Facts
We all know our 2s facts, right? 2 x 1 = 2, 2 x 2 = 4, 2 x 3 = 6... That's the foundation of our superpower. Think of it like knowing your ABCs before writing a novel. They're the simple building blocks.
So, how do we use this for 4 x 9? Here's the secret: remember that 4 is just 2 x 2.

Breaking Down 4 x 9
Let's rewrite 4 x 9 as (2 x 2) x 9. See what we did there? We just swapped out the 4 for its equivalent, 2 x 2.
Now, the order of multiplication doesn't matter. This is called the associative property, but don't worry about the fancy name. Just remember you can shuffle things around. So, we can rewrite (2 x 2) x 9 as 2 x (2 x 9). This is where the magic happens!
What is 2 x 9? You probably know it's 18. That's our 2s fact in action!

So now we have 2 x (2 x 9) which simplifies to 2 x 18.
The Grand Finale: Doubling Time!
Our problem is now 2 x 18. Doubling 18 might seem a little scary at first, but let's break it down again. Think of 18 as 10 + 8. So, 2 x 18 is the same as 2 x (10 + 8).
We can distribute that 2: (2 x 10) + (2 x 8). This is just a fancy way of saying we're doubling both the 10 and the 8.

2 x 10 is 20, and 2 x 8 is 16. Add them together: 20 + 16 = 36.
Ta-da! 4 x 9 = 36. You did it!
Let's Recap, Just in Case
- Recognize that 4 x 9 is the same as (2 x 2) x 9.
- Rearrange to make it 2 x (2 x 9).
- Solve 2 x 9, which is 18.
- Now you have 2 x 18.
- Double 18 to get 36.
Why This Matters
This isn't just about memorizing a trick. It's about understanding how numbers relate to each other. When you see that 4 is just double double, you start to see patterns and connections everywhere. This kind of thinking makes math less intimidating and more like a puzzle you can solve.

Plus, imagine the possibilities! You can use this same logic for other numbers. Want to multiply something by 8? That's just doubling three times! (Because 8 is 2 x 2 x 2).
